History and Significance of UAE National Day
The story of UAE National Day 2025 goes back to the founding of the nation in 1971. Before unification, the region consisted of independent Emirates, each governed separately. On December 2, 1971, six Emirates — Abu Dhabi, Dubai, Sharjah, Ajman, Umm Al-Quwain, and Fujairah — united to form the United Arab Emirates. Later, Ras Al Khaimah joined in 1972, completing the union of seven Emirates.
This day celebrates the vision and leadership of the UAE’s Founding Father, Sheikh Zayed bin Sultan Al Nahyan, who played a key role in establishing unity, peace, and prosperity. Today, the UAE stands as one of the most developed nations in the Middle East, representing harmony between modernity and tradition.

Cultural Highlights During UAE National Day 2025
The UAE National Day 2025 celebrations are not just about fireworks — they are also about celebrating the nation’s heritage and culture. The country takes pride in showcasing its Emirati traditions through various cultural programs:
Traditional Music and Dance: Performances of Al Ayala and Harbiya dance take place in public squares.
Camel Parades and Falconry Shows: Reflecting the UAE’s desert heritage, these events attract locals and tourists alike.
Henna Art and Arabic Calligraphy Booths: Popular among visitors who wish to experience Emirati culture firsthand.
Local Cuisine: Try Emirati dishes such as Al Harees, Machboos, and Luqaimat in local markets.
Dubai beautifully blends modern celebrations with cultural traditions, making it a perfect reflection of the UAE’s identity.
UAE National Day Decorations and Symbols
During the celebrations, the country is decorated in red, green, white, and black — the colors of the UAE flag. Here’s what each color symbolizes:
Color | Meaning |
---|---|
Red | Courage and strength |
Green | Prosperity and growth |
White | Peace and honesty |
Black | Power and dignity |
Buildings, bridges, and roads are illuminated with LED lights, and you’ll find flags displayed proudly on vehicles, homes, and shops. The atmosphere throughout the Emirates is filled with pride and unity.
